@JanisV from Portable Antiquities Scheme can be taken in an easy way (from xml or JSON) completing the references in the program. They are very well structured by the British Museum. This is a very valuable resource because it is from a museum and is probably as generic and correct as possible.

It is worth to complete the following references: Periods - have them by year. Denominations - they are linked by period and material. Mints - are linked by period Ruler - linked by period and mintage
